This post compares Barnstable, Massachusetts to Brockton, Massachusetts across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Barnstable (city) Brockton (city)
Population 44,325 95,161
Income (median) $50,871 $43,645
Home Value (median) $355,800 $237,000
White 91% 42%
Black 4% 40%
Asian 0% 1%
With Kids 22% 39%
Age (median) 48 35
Rentals 25% 46%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Barnstable or Brockton?
A: Barnstable has a much smaller population count than Brockton: 44325 compared with 95161 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Barnstable or in Brockton?
A: Incomes are on average higher in Barnstable.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Barnstable or Brockton?
A: Homes tend to be more expensive in Barnstable.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Brockton does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 25% for Barnstable versus 46% for Brockton.
